Built for technical ski traverses, this backpack is lightweight and comfortable with full-spec alpine features. Its snow-shedding LiteSnow back system delivers a dry back and carrying comfort, with a solid fit. The roll-top opening and height-adjustable lid means the volume can be expanded without restricting head movement. With attachments for skis, a rope and ice axes, and quick access to avalanche gear and the main compartment, it's ideal for challenging multi-day alpine journeys.

- D stands for Denier – a unit of measurement for yarn weight. 600D means that 9,000 meters of yarn weigh 600 grams. The higher the value, the more robust (and often heavier) the material.
- PES stands for Polyester. Polyester fibers are highly tear- and abrasion-resistant, easy to care for, and absorb very little moisture.
- PA stands for Polyamide (also known as nylon). Polyamide fibers are especially durable, elastic, and lightweight – ideal for textiles subject to high stress.
- REC stands for Recycled – the material is made entirely or partially from recycled resources.
- BS stands for bluesign®-certified – the material has been produced in an environmentally friendly and sustainable way according to the bluesign® standard.

SL Women’s Fit
This model is also available in the SL version. The SL back length is specific for women: on average, women have shorter backs than men. The carrying system in the SL model is therefore somewhat shorter than in the deuter standard backpacks. In addition, the carrying system is specially adapted to the female anatomy. Certificates
Green Button certified product
This product carries the Green Button for its textile components. deuter works with the Green Button, a German government-run certification label for textile products.
The Green Button sets social and environmental requirements for textile production and checks whether these requirements are met within the certification scope. It also looks at how the company works, including management and purchasing practices.

Made without intentionally added PFAS
PFAS, sometimes also referred to as PFCs, have been used in outdoor textile finishes for their water-, dirt-, and greaserepellent properties. Many PFAS are highly persistent and can accumulate in the environment over time.
Since 2020, deuter has used DWR (Durable Water Repellent) finishes without intentionally added PFAS. These finishes are selected in line with deuter’s chemical management requirements and applicable product safety standards.
